The successful applicant may be someone who is just starting out on their career in education, or maybe an experienced Teaching Assistant looking for a new opportunity. It is essential that they have a compassionate approach to supporting students from a range of backgrounds, with varying Special Educational Needs. You will be mainly classroom based and working under the direction of the SENCO, alongside our fantastic team of Teaching Assistants. Our Teaching Assistants are given time to plan and prepare, as well as a weekly joint planning session where ideas and support can be shared within the team.

Presdales School is a single sex comprehensive school in Ware for girls aged 11-18, with boys welcomed in the Sixth Form. We have a long tradition of providing an outstanding education for our students. Formerly Ware Grammar School for Girls, which opened in 1906, we became Presdales School in the mid-1960s, and a fully comprehensive school in the early 1970s. The mansion house, which fronts the school, and our stunning grounds provide a calm and relaxed atmosphere for our school community.

We are very proud of the high academic standards that our students achieve, regardless of their starting point. Our motto, ‘Achievement for All’, runs through all that we do.
